Appearing in a YouTube video with social media star Bloveslife, the rapper details how the aftermath of getting fat transfer and butt enhancement caused her body to have a bad reaction.

AceShowbiz - Dream Doll really needs to be more careful when she wants to go under the knife after this. The "Love & Hip Hop: New York" star recently collaborated with YouTuber Bloveslife on a Mukbang video, in which she talked about various things, including the time when she almost died after getting a plastic surgery in Columbia.

The ladies were discussing Dream's boobs size when the conversation turned into plastic surgery. When Bloveslife asked her about it, she began detailing the story about how the aftermath of getting fat transfer and butt enhancement caused her body to have a bad reaction to the point where she nearly died. "I got sick," she said. "It started, like, rejecting of my skin. It was the worst experience in my life."

Thankfully, she was saved by her doctor when she was still in Columbia because she didn't want to go to hospital. If she were to go there, she said that the staff there would "cut up" her body. Dream also pointed out that she didn't feel "nauseous," adding, "I was in pain. It was red, it was warm, it was hard. I was sick." Hearing her explanation, Bloveslife couldn't help but recalling K. Michelle's story in which she opened up about the horrific removal of her butt injection procedure.

In an interview with PEOPLE, Michelle said that she had to endure four surgeries and two blood transfusions as a result of illegal silicone injection. "It's the scariest thing in life, and I'm a tough girl. I had these lumps and I was very disfigured," the "Love & Hip Hop: Atlanta" star said at the time, as she also warned others, "Now we know the outcome of these [injections]. Before it was up in the air, but now we know the outcome, that your body cannot handle foreign objects in it."
